冬小麦对不同时期施用的尿素N的吸收利用

摘    要:本文应用~(15)N尿素研究了不同施肥时期下尿素N在土壤中的转化和小麦对肥料氮的吸收利用。结果表明,尿素施入土壤后,硝态氮含量急剧增加。播前底施尿素有更多的硝态氮累积在20~40cm土层中。小麦对肥料氮的吸收高峰在4月13~18日,即拔节孕穗期,高峰期的吸氮量与小麦产量呈正相关,r=0.7715。

NITROGEN TRANSFORMATION IN SOLL AND ITS UPTAKE BY WINTER WHEAT
Abstract:The nitrogen transformation in soil and its uptake by winter wheat at the different growth stage were studied by using 15N-urea.The results indicated that NO3--N content in soil increased rapidly when the urea was applid.It was found that about 90% of the NO3--N content was in layer between 0 and 20cm in depth.There were two peaks of N absorption for wheat.One was in the jointing-booting stage and another was in the filling stage.The amount of nitrogen uptake at tne first peak stage showed a positive correlation to the yield of wheat,r=0.7715.The results also indicated that there were correlation between dry weight of wheat,the amount of nitrogen uptake and the nitrogen content in the fertilizer.And,nitrogen in fertilizer and that in soil were absorbed by wheat in proper proportion.
